In February 2025 we hosted a Sustainability in Practice event at The Hub. The event explored how the Arts Industry is adapting to meet Sustainability targets.
We welcomed an audience of enthusiastic spectators from across the world of Culture and Sustainability. Attendees included Creative Scotland, Edinburgh Chamber of Commerce, Festivals Edinburgh, Scottish Ballet, as well as our own staff.
Susan McIntosh, Director of Finance and Commercial at the International Festival, opened the event by highlighting our commitment to reducing emissions by adopting the British Standards Institute’s Net Zero Pathway to all areas of our work.
A range of speakers shared their insight and learnings with the group, speaking directly from their experience working in the field of sustainability in the arts.

Sorcha Coller and Lucie Pierron from Askonas Holt, a leading international arts company specialising in classical music, shared their thoughts on sustainable touring and the challenges that arise. They discussed how sustainable planning and collaborative touring; and partnerships and building new working models are the two greatest opportunities for change in touring.

Gemma Swallow highlighted the incredible work she had conducted bringing the Theatre Green Book to life for National Theatre Scotland’s productions.
Implementing a framework such as the Theatre Greenbook is a great way of making sure all stakeholders know the requirements of projects from the onset.Gemma Swallow

Scott Morrison, captured the often neglected artists perspective towards International Touring through the launch of the Scottish Classical Sustainability Group’s research study. He spoke on how organisations need to do more to engage artists in their work on sustainability.
There was a real enthusiasm in the room that we must manifest and turn into actions as we approach 2030. A common thread amongst speakers was the need for collaboration and utilising networks and we will do our best to facilitate this wherever possibleTerry Roberts, Environmental Sustainability Manager at Edinburgh International Festival
